Elon Musk’s estranged daughter, Vivian Wilson, told Teen Vogue in an interview published Thursday that her father’s “Nazi salute” at President Donald Trump’s inauguration rally “was insane.”

“The Nazi salute shit was insane,” Wilson, 20, said. “Honey, we’re going to call a fig a fig, and we’re going to call a Nazi salute what it was. That shit was definitely a Nazi salute. The crowd is equally to blame, and I feel like people are not talking about that. That crowd should be denounced.”

Wilson, who came out as trans when she was still a teenager, has spoken before about her estranged relationship with Musk and said he would berate her as a child for being queer.

She told Teen Vogue that she hasn’t spoken to him since 2020. “Thank God,” she said.

Wilson also said she doesn’t know how many siblings — or rather, half-siblings — she has. Musk reportedly has 14 children with four different women, and Wilson said she found out about Musk’s child with influencer Ashley St. Clair and his second child with the singer Grimes on Reddit.

“If I had a nickel for every time I found out I had half-siblings through Reddit, I’d have two nickels,” Wilson told Teen Vogue.

She said she’s not in communication with Grimes or anyone on that side of the family and has only met X, one of Grimes’ children with Musk whom he often takes to White House photo-ops, once.

On social media, Wilson has been outspoken about her political beliefs. She told Teen Vogue that she thinks the U.S. is moving in a “terrifying” direction.

“Every time I open my phone to read the news, I kind of just stare at the wall for 10 minutes,” she said. “It’s horrifying what they’re doing, not only to the trans community, but also to migrants, to communities of color, to so many marginalized communities that are being systematically targeted by the new administration and having protections revoked. It’s cartoonishly evil.”

Musk, who heads the non-Cabinet-level Department of Government Efficiency, has slashed government jobs and become a trusted adviser to Trump. In recent years, he has leaned even farther right in his politics, and Wilson forcefully pushed back on the notion that it was due to her coming out.

“It’s such a convenient narrative, that the reason he turned right is because I’m a fucking tranny, and that’s just not the case,” Wilson said. “That’s not what that does to people. Him going further on the right, and I’m going to use the word ‘further’ — make sure you put ‘further’ in there — is not because of me. That’s insane.”
